Recruitment stages

Our five stage interview process

  1. Review - Our Talent Specialists review applications and sense check against the core competencies of the role.
  2. Online interview - We complete an informal video interview with you to get to know you better and tell you more about us!
  3. Formal interview - We complete a more in-depth interview with you (either online or onsite) including competency based questioning or a task.
  4. Feedback - We ensure each and every candidates that has invested time with us through this process receives constructive feedback.
  5. Offer - We make our offer to the candidate not just most suited to the role but also aligned to our company values and culture.
